Topsoil installation involves the process of adding a fresh layer of soil to a property’s landscape to improve its overall health and appearance. This service typically includes grading the existing ground, preparing the surface, and spreading high-quality topsoil evenly across the area. Proper installation ensures that plants, grass, and other landscaping features have a nutrient-rich foundation to grow strong and thrive. Whether starting a new lawn, repairing erosion, or preparing a garden bed, professional topsoil installation can provide the foundation needed for successful landscaping projects.

This service helps address common landscaping problems such as poor soil quality, uneven ground, and drainage issues. When soil has become compacted, depleted of nutrients, or contaminated, plants may struggle to grow, and lawns can become patchy or thin. Topsoil installation can restore fertility and improve soil structure, promoting healthier grass and plant growth. Additionally, it can help correct uneven terrain or prevent water runoff problems by creating a more level and stable surface, making outdoor spaces safer and more functional.

The overview below groups typical Topsoil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or topsoil repairs or patching,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and scope of the area to be covered.

Standard Installation - Full topsoil installation for average-sized lawns us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. This range covers most residential projects and reflects common project sizes and complexities.

Large or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ate topsoil installations can range from $3,500 to $7,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this highest tier, often involving extensive prep work or challenging site conditions.

Full Replacement - Complete topsoil replacement on large properties generally costs $4,000 to $10,000+. These projects tend to be on the higher end due to the volume of material and labor involved, though most work remains in the middle ranges for typical sites.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is topsoil installation? Topsoil installation involves adding a layer of quality soil to improve the ground for landscaping, gardening, or lawn growth. Local contractors can prepare and spread the soil to enhance your outdoor space.

How do local service providers prepare for topsoil installation? They typically assess the existing ground conditions, remove debris or old soil if needed, and then distribute and level the new topsoil for optimal coverage and planting conditions.

What types of projects are suitable for topsoil installation? Topsoil installation is ideal for establishing new lawns, gardens, flower beds, or improving soil quality in existing landscapes to support healthy plant growth.

What factors influence the quality of topsoil used in installation? The quality depends on the soil’s nutrient content, texture, and organic matter. Reputable local contractors source topsoil that meets these standards for better planting results.
